Transaction 37c5609f13014aea90a3d0249b2aafc63761ece369c27fab40ac76edca954885
2 Input
2 Outputs
- 37c5609f13014aea90a3d0249b2aafc63761ece369c27fab40ac76edca954885:0
- 37c5609f13014aea90a3d0249b2aafc63761ece369c27fab40ac76edca954885:1
value 11110000
address 1FpEy1oBrFBA721nrhCXa4JoVYohbU1v6r
value 37172
address 16rPwapNLUveDeKWQTEXSF47ss8rxsAenX